Here’s What You’ll Do for Our Residents & Facility:
Care Needs & Planning: Assist to develop, implement and continually update individual care plans, supplement hands on care needs
Assessments: Complete admission, discharge and other assessments as needed
Triage & Interventions: Assist to handle acute health changes, physicians' orders and collaboration with care providers & families
Regulatory Standards: Ensure compliance with federal, state, county & company health/safety regulations
Quality Assurance: Audit documentation & care for quality control/compliance
Family & Team Liaison: Communicates changes in resident conditions to families/providers, works collaboratively with the interdisciplinary team
Team Oversight & Mentorship: Provide ongoing training, orientation & performance evaluations for staff. Manage staffing schedules and assignments
